Let's start with the mobile check-in wizardry. Last Thursday, stuck in a taxi during rush-hour traffic, I completed check-in for my Taipei-bound flight in 90 seconds. The app remembered my passport details from previous scans – no more fumbling with documents while vehicles honked. For my New York trips, the 24-hour check-in window feels like a secret weapon against JFK chaos. That satisfying vibration when the boarding pass appears? Pure relief.
The real-time flight management feature saved my Barcelona connection last month. Pushing my stroller through Terminal 4, I got a vibration alert about gate change before any announcement echoed. The map-guided dash to Gate C74 felt like having air traffic control in my palm. Their Dynasty Sky Reading library became my transatlantic sanctuary. On the red-eye from Amsterdam, I downloaded architectural journals that stayed accessible for two days post-landing. When turbulence hit over Greenland, losing myself in Scandinavian design essays eased white-knuckled tension. No more weighing luggage with books!
Meal pre-ordering is where the app shines brightest. Flying premium economy to Sydney, I secured my herb-crusted salmon 14 days early. But the real triumph came when my daughter developed dairy intolerance mid-vacation. At 2 AM local time, I modified her meal for the return flight – no stressful calls to customer service. The steward's nod when presenting her special plate felt like a silent high-five.
I've developed rituals around seat selection. Every Christmas flight home, I secure 11A while sipping hot chocolate at my neighborhood café. The animated seat map revealing extra legroom spots feels like uncovering hidden treasure. Last June, grouping six colleagues on the Osaka route took three taps – previously an hour-long email chain.
Ancillary services reveal thoughtful touches. Booking high-speed rail transfers within the app creates seamless transitions – stepping off the plane directly into train seat 8F without ticket queues. The Wi-Fi purchase option mid-flight during sudden work emergencies? Career-saving.
My boarding pass ritual now centers on the My Wallet section. After nearly missing a connection when paper tickets stuck together, I cherish how passes auto-sort chronologically. That crisp digital swipe through security gates never loses its magic.
The pros? It launches faster than my weather app – critical during last-minute gate sprints. Push notifications arrive before airport displays update. But I wish the meal customization allowed flavor notes beyond dietary restrictions. Once over the Atlantic, my vegan curry lacked the spice kick I craved.
